Name: Aminobacter niigataensis Urakami et al. 1992
Etymology: ni.i.ga.ta.en’sis. N.L. masc. adj. niigataensis, pertaining to the Niigata region of Japan [probably better: niigatensis]
Pronunciation, gender: … ni-i-ga-ta-EN-sis, masculine
Type strain: ATCC 49932; CCUG 48820; DM-81; DSM 7050; JCM 7853

Valid publication:
Urakami T, Araki H, Oyanagi H, Suzuki KI, Komagata K. Transfer of Pseudomonas aminovorans (den Dooren de Jong 1926) to Aminobacter gen. nov. as Aminobacter aminovorans comb. nov. and description of Aminobacter aganoensis sp. nov. and Aminobacter niigataensis sp. nov. Int. J. Syst. Bacteriol. 1992; 42:84-92. 🇯🇵
IJSEM list:
Anonymous. Notification list. Notification that new names and new combinations have appeared in volume 42, part 1 of the IJSB. Int J Syst Bacteriol 1992; 42:328-329.
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P
Taxonomic status: correct name
Parent taxon: Aminobacter Urakami et al. 1992
